Use of services prior to and following intensive family preservation services
Article Abstract:
This article provides an evaluation of intensive family preservation services (IFPS), a short term service that provides support to families who have at least one child who is facing out-of-home placement. The author maintains IFPS have been considered by many of its critics as ineffective due to the short duration of the service, but states IFPS therapists often direct families to more individualized services.

Treatment Foster Care in a system of care: sequences and correlates of residential placements
Article Abstract:
This article evaluates Treatment Foster Care for children with mental disorders and aggressive behavior. The authors examined residential placements, comparing the outcomes with group homes or residential treatment, and maintain the results are inconclusive and more research must be conducted.

Helping children access and use services: a review
Article Abstract:
This article discusses how to prevent the high drop out rates for mental health services for children. The author evaluates engagement intervention, maintaining it is moderately successful.
